How did geography shape the Aztec civilization in Mesoamerica?

Description

This educational resource explores the Aztec civilization's development in Mesoamerica, focusing on how geographic and environmental factors influenced their settlement, technological advancements, and cultural practices. Students will analyze the diverse physical geography of Mesoamerica, including highlands, lakes, and varying climates, and understand how these elements shaped the Aztecs' way of life. Key topics include the creation of chinampas (floating gardens) for agriculture, the strategic location of Tenochtitlan on Lake Texcoco, and innovations in urban planning.
